计算机辅助设计主讲:王继龙教材:,AutoCAD实用教程,
邱志惠等编著西安电子科技大学出版社第 一 章绪 论
1.1 概述在人类的社会与科技发展史上,图画和图形占据重要的地位,人们往往习惯于用图来描述生活和表达思想。
随着人类社会生产规模的扩大和科学技术的进步,图形作为一种重要的工具和信息载体,其绘制的精度和数度要求也不断提高,图形的种类也日趋繁多和复杂。为了对各种图形进行更为深入的研究和应用,人们运用数学方法来描述他们的性质和规律,即所谓的形数结合。通常任何一个图形都可以由数学方程式来表示或逼近;反之,
很多数学问题也可用图形来形象的表达。
随着形数理论的研究逐步深入,有些图形的数学表达式十分复杂(例如曲面等),用人工计算是非常困难的,或者需要很长时间,这就直接影响到对复杂图形的研究。计算机出现之后,人们想到了用计算机来完成形数结合的工作,即不仅用计算机来计算图形,
同时也用它来绘制图形。 20世纪 50年代美国的哥勃
( Gerber)公司和卡尔康( Calcomp)公司先后研制成功平板式和滚筒式自动绘图机,成为电子计算机的新型外部设备。
由计算机控制的自动绘图机的出现,使图学工作进入一个崭新的阶段。在计算机科学 ﹑ 应用数学?图学等学科的基础上,综合发展成一门新的学科 —计算机图学( Computer Graphics )。计算机图学的研究对象是运用计算机的先进技术,对图形进行数学处理,进而研究图学领域中的各种理论和实践问题。
它既不同于单纯用数学方式研究图形和几何学,也不同于用一般数学计算来研究各种图形的纯数学方法,
而用计算机处理各种图学问题,并将结果输出到显示器绘图机或图形数据文件等。
在工程设计中人们不仅需要绘图,而且要进行结构设计计算,即所谓的计算机辅助设计( CAD—
Computer Aided Design),就是利用计算机帮助人们进行工程设计,然后用计算机控制的自动绘图及绘制出符合工程需要的图样或输出到数据文件。
20世纪 60年代末至 70年代中期逐渐形成专门的
CAD工业,代表性的公司如 Intergraph和 Calcomp等。
早期的 CAD仅运行在大中型计算机上,主要是大企业和大公司应用,普及性很差。 80年代以后,
随着微型计算机的普及和发展,CAD技术才得到了广泛的普及和发展。至今 CAD的应用已经遍及工业 ﹑ 农业 ﹑ 国防和科学研究的各个方面,用途及其广泛。
在飞机 ﹑ 造船 ﹑ 汽车工业中可以绘制高精度的理论外形模线和结构模线;在电子工业中可以绘制精密的印刷电路图 ﹑ 逻辑图 ﹑ 电路图 ﹑ 布线图和大规模集成电路的掩膜图;在机械工业中绘制装配图 ﹑ 零件工作图等;在土木建筑中绘制透视效果图 ﹑ 建筑施工图 ﹑ 结构施工图和设备施工图等;在地质 ﹑ 测量 ﹑ 勘探领域中绘制各种地图 ﹑ 地质构造图;在气象领域绘制气象分析图 ﹑ 预报图;在医疗卫生领域绘制人体解剖图 ﹑ B 超 ﹑ CT 图像;在服装领域绘制服装设计图;在艺术领域绘制动画片美术片等。
AutoCAD绘图软件包是美国 Autodesk公司于 1982
年首次推出的用于微机的计算机辅助设计与绘图的通用软件包。由于该软件具有简单易学 ﹑ 功能齐全
﹑ 应用广泛 ﹑ 兼容性和二次开发性强等很多优点,
所以很受广大设计人员的欢迎。 AutoCAD2002是该公司目前发布的最新版本,相对于以前的版本,它进一步改进了使用的便捷性,提供了新颖的效率工具,
增强了性能以及与其它 CAD数据的兼容性。与传统的手工绘图相比,计算机绘图有以下优点:
1.复杂数据的处理能力,极大的提高了绘图的精度及速度;
2.强大的图形处理能力,能够很好的完成工程设计中二维及三维图形处理,并能够随意控制图形的显示 ﹑ 平移 ﹑ 旋转和复制全部或部分图形;
3.良好的文字处理能力,可方便的添加文字符号;
4.快捷的尺寸自动测量标注自动导航捕捉等功能;
5.具有曲面造型 ﹑ 实体造型等功能,可实现渲染 ﹑
真实感 ﹑ 虚拟现实等效果。
6.友好的用户界面 ﹑ 方便的人机交互 ﹑ 准确自动的全作图过程纪录;
7.有效的图形数据管理 ﹑ 查询及系统标准化;
8.良好的系统兼容性,软件本身的向上兼容性以及与其它 CAD系统共享数据接口;
9.强大的二次开发能力,用户可根据自己的需求,用软件自带的开发工具或软件提供的高级语言接口,
对软件进行二次开发 ;
10.先进的网络技术,包括局域网 ﹑ 企业内联网和
Internet互联网上的数据共享,实现远程设计。
1.2计算机绘图系统的构成计算机绘图系统主要包括两部分,硬件系统和软件系统,硬件包括主机和外围设备等,软件包括操作系统 ﹑CAD 软件和编程语言等。
计算机绘图系统的硬件有三大组成:输入设备中心处理设备输出设备。图 1-1是硬件设备系统的构成图。
计算机绘图系统的主要硬件设备包括计算机(主机 ﹑ 显示器和鼠标),绘图机或打印机。
计算机是整个系统的核心,其余是外围设备。绘图机按纸张放置的形式分为平板式和滚筒式,按,笔,
的形式分为笔试 ﹑ 喷墨式和静电光栅式。应用广泛的喷墨或激光打印机,其出图效果也很好,在所绘图样不是很大的情况下,可以作为首选方案。
运行 AutoCAD2002的基本配置如下:
Pentium450以上的处理器,64M以上的内存,
1024X768 SVGA显卡,1GB硬盘,20XCD-RAM,56K
Modem及打印机。
Windows98 Windows2000 ﹑NT ﹑ XP 操作系统,
IE5.0浏览器。
1.3 AutoCAD绘图系统的主界面
AutoCAD的主界面如图 1-2所示,其中包括标题栏 ﹑ 菜单区 ﹑ 工具条 ﹑ 绘图区 ﹑ 命令区及状态行。
工具条标题栏 菜单区命令区绘图区状态行图 1-2 AutoCAD绘图系统主界面
1.标题栏一般基于 windows环境下的应用程序都有标题栏,
标题栏在界面的最上方,显示当前正在工作的软件名及文件名。
2.主菜单
AutoCAD2002主界面的第二行为菜单区,主菜单包括文件( File) ﹑ 编辑( Edit) ﹑ 视图( View) ﹑
插入( Insert) ﹑ 格式( Format) ﹑ 工具( Tools)
﹑ 绘制( Draw) ﹑ 标注( Dimension) ﹑ 窗口
( Window)和帮助( Help)等十一个菜单项,每个菜单项下都有下拉菜单项,AutoCAD的主要命令均放置在下拉菜单中,用鼠标点选菜单项,即展开该项下拉菜单。
3.图标菜单打开主菜单视图 (View)中的最后一项命令工具条( toolbars)的对话框,通过自选,可随时打开或关闭各类工具条。 AutoCAD的常用命令在工具条中均有形象化的位置。
4.绘图区屏幕中间部分是绘图区,在 AutoCAD的系统配置中,用户可根据喜好选择绘图区的背景色。
5.命令区命令窗口如图 1-4,其作用是输入命令和参数。
图 1-4 命令窗口
6.状态行状态行在界面的下面,如图 1-5,包括坐标提示捕捉正交等功能的打开和关闭。
图 1-5 状态行
1.4 AutoCAD绘图系统的命令输入方式
1.下拉菜单用鼠标点击菜单区,每一项下对应一条下拉菜单,用鼠标点击即可进入该命令。教材表 1-1列出
AutoCAD2002下拉菜单的中英文命令。在下拉菜单中,
凡命令后有,…” 的,即有下一级对话框;凡命令有,?” 的,即表示有下一级子菜单。
2.图标菜单(工具条)
在 AutoCAD 系统默认状态下有四个工具条:
标准工具条 ﹑ 物体特性工具条 ﹑ 绘图工具条和修改工具条。此外,还可根据需要打开其他工具条,每个工具条有一组图标,用鼠标点取即可进入该命令。
工具条与对应的下拉菜单不完全相同,其具体内容将在后面各章介绍。
3.键入命令所有命令均可通过键盘在命令区输入。无论是工具条还是下拉菜单,都不包含所有命令,特别是一些系统变量,必须从命令区输入。
4.重复命令任何一个刚用过的命令,均可按回车键(或鼠标右键)重复该命令。
5.快捷键快捷键用来代替一些常用命令的操作,只需键入命令的第一个字母或前三个字母即可。常用的快捷键见教材表 1-2。
在 AutoCAD中当命令区出现,命令:,或
,Command:,时(如图 1-6),表示进入命令等待状态,可用以上介绍的几种方式输入命令。
图 1-6
1.5 AutoCAD绘图系统中的坐标输入方式
AutoCAD在绘图中可使用多种坐标系统来定义空间点的位置。 AutoCAD初始默认的坐标系叫世界通用坐标系( WCS),在绘图中是不可改变的,但用户可以自己定义用户坐标系( UCS),用户坐标系
( UCS)将在三维部分介绍。 AutoCAD绘图系统中坐标点的输入方式有以下几种:
1.绝对坐标输入一个点的绝对坐标的格式为( X,Y,Z),
在系统默认的状态下,绘图区左下角有一个图标,
若仅输入 X,Y则系统默认 z值为零。
2.相对坐标输入一个点的相对坐标的格式为( @ΔX,ΔY,
ΔZ ),即输入 X,Y,Z三个方向相对于前一点的坐标增量。
3.极坐标输入一个点的极坐标的格式为( R<θ<φ ),R
为线长,θ 为相对 X轴的角度,φ 为相对 XY平面的角度。
4.相对极坐标输入一个点相对极坐标的格式为( @R<θ<φ )。
5.长度和方向当打开状态行的正交或极轴开关时,用鼠标确定方向,输入一个长度即可,格式为( R),R为线长。
图 1-7位几种坐标的图例。
图 1-7 AutoCAD坐标系统
1.6 AutoCAD绘图系统中选取图素的方式在 AutoCAD中,所有的编辑及修改命令均要选择已绘制好的图素,常用的选择方式有以下几种:
1.点选当需要选取图素时(命令区出现,选择对象:,或,Select Object:”),鼠标变成一个小方块,用鼠标直接点取被选目标,图素变虚则表示被选中。
2.窗选在,选择对象:,后键入,W”,或用鼠标在图素对角点击,打开一个窗口,一次可以选取多个图素。
3.其它常用方式在出现,选择对象:,后键入,L(Last)”,
表示所选的是最近一次绘制的图素;键入,Cp”,可选取多边形窗口;键入,All”,表示所选取是全部
(冻结层除外);键入,R(Remove)”,再用鼠标直接点取相应图素,将其移出选择;键入,U(Undo)”,
取消选择。
AutoCAD选择方式还有很多,此处不再赘述。
1.7 AutoCAD绘图系统中功能键的作用熟练掌握功能键可以加快绘图速度,各功能键的定义见教材表 1-3。
1.8 AutoCAD绘图系统中的部分常用设置功能
AutoCAD有许多配置功能,此处仅介绍部分常用功能。在主菜单工具( Tools)中,选择下拉菜单中的最后一个菜单项,即打开选项( Options)对话框,如图 1-8所示。(注意:初学者不宜随意进行系统配置,
如配置不当,在使用中将造成不必要的麻烦。)
1,文件用于指定文件夹,供 AutoCAD搜索不再当前文件夹中的文字 ﹑ 菜单 ﹑ 模块 ﹑ 图形 ﹑ 线型和图案等,
如图 1-8。
2,显示图 1-8 选项 --文件打开选项中的显示对话框,如图 1-9所示。
设置绘图区的底色 ﹑ 字体 ﹑ 圆和立体的平滑度等。
图 1-9 选项 —显示
1)点击,颜色,按钮,显示如图 1-10所示对话框。
可以设置背景和光标颜色。
2)点击,字体,按钮,显示如图 1-11所示对话框。
可以设置命令行窗口的文字形式。
3.打开和保存 图 1-12
打开选项中的打开和保存对话框,如图 1-12所示。在这里主要设置文件保存的格式及自动保存的间隔时间等。
4.打印 图 1-13 选项 —打印打开选项中的打印对话框,打印设置将在打印一节中详述。
5.系统 图 1-14 选项 —系统打开选项中的系统对话框,在这里设置绘制新图时启动对话框的格式。
6.用户系统配置 图 1-15 选项 --用户系统配置打开选项中的用户系统配置对话框,设置绘图中使用快捷键等参数。
尺寸标注关联
7.草图 图 1-16 选项 —草图打开选项中的草图对话框,在这里主要设置捕捉标记的颜色 ﹑ 大小及靶框的大小等。
8,选择 图 1-17 选项 —选择打开选项中的选择对话框,在这里主要设置绘图时夹点的颜色和大小等。
9,用户配置 图 1-18 选项 —用户配置打开选项中的用户配置对话框,在这里主要设置绘新图时的配置。
1.9 关于 AutoCAD2002的几点说明
AutoCAD2002的界面对话框等与 AutoCAD2000
大致相同,在内容上主要增加了一些网络功能,并在启动时增加了一个,AutoCAD今日,的界面。使用
AutoCAD2002不仅可以实现图形数据共享,还可以使用增强属性提取功能来总结和输出属性数据到一个外部的应用程序中。利用 Microsoft Access和 Excel
可以创建材料表,使用 Design XML工具可从你的 DWG
文件中抽取图形和非图形两种信息,提供给需查看或编辑的设计组成员们,而他们并不需要安装
AutoCAD软件。 AutoCAD2002 提供最新和最先进的工具来增强合作的过程,如电子传播 ﹑ AutoCAD 今日 ﹑ 增强属性提取 ﹑ XML 设计 ﹑ Web 发布 ﹑ 更先进的 DXF文件格式和直接连到 Autodesk Point A站点
,我的文件,的文件向导,以及一组强大的 ﹑ 全新的具有内部网 /互联网功能的 CAD标准管理工具,在交互式核查 ﹑ 报批等工作中,都可以确保你的所共享的信息的完整性。当然,AutoCAD2002还提供了全新的增强的高效特征,如关联标注及图层文本和属性工具。通过图块属性管理器,不需要打散或重定义图块,就可以改变块中的属性和属性特征,使更改立即反映到已创建的块插入中。
1,网络功能在标准工具条中,增加的网络功能如图 1-19。
图 1-19 标准工具条网上发布网络开会我的文件电子传递
CAD
今日实时助手
“AutoCAD今日,,可通过实时的浏览器连接到 Autodesk Point A这类面向个人用户的设计资源网站。,我的文件,,可以部分预览和打开最近使用的文件。他使用增强的最近访问( MRU)列表特征。
,现在网络开会,,是一个协作工具,使广义的设计组成员可以通过网络进行设计思想和修改的探讨。
CAD管理员也能用现在开会功能实现直接的在线培训。
,电子传递,,可以把当前的图形和相关的文件
(外部参照文件 ﹑ 字体文件 ﹑ 位图文件)打包到一个单独的传送集中。电子传递支持从图形文件到标准文件的连接,它解决了过去图形文件传递慢的问题。,使用电子打印,功能可以将 DWG文件转换为轻装的只读的 DWF问及间,即使你的组员没有安装
AutoCAD软件,也能最真实的浏览和打印它。
2,实时助手
AutoCAD2002的实时助手如图 1-20,它随时显示当前使用命令的功能说明信息,大大方便了初学者的学习和使用。帮助功能也得到了增强,其帮助对话框如图 1-21。
图 1-21 图 1-20